OCHA Nigeria Borno State Weekly Situation Report No. 3

OCHA Nigeria Borno State Weekly Situation Report No. 3

Highlights • Food and nutrition partners reach over 40,000 people with vital supplies in Damasak border town as more internally displaced persons (IDPs) and refugee-returnees arrive. • 230 cases of several acute malnutrition (SAM) identified in Rann border town as partners intensify critical services. • Over 2,200 new arrivals facing shelter gaps amid increasing influx in Ngala LGA. • 68 cases of measles and two related fatalities as access constraints impede vaccination in some high-risk locations. • Over 1,100 IDPs affected by flash flooding in Dikwa LGA. • President Buhari commissions 4,000 new homes as part of durable housing solutions for IDPs.
